King of All Media

Howard Stern may be the king of all media but Rush Limbaugh is the king of conservative talk radio. Limbaugh’s smooth polished style along with his biting sense of humor has vaulted him to the pinnacle of the talk radio airwaves. The man behind the golden microphone high atop the EIB network does not work cheap.

 Limbaugh comfortably ensconced in the Limbaugh Institute for Advanced Conservative Studies and Clear Channel Communication Inc inked a deal to pay Limbaugh $400 million. The deal makes him the highest paid radio personality in history. With Conservative listeners around the country tuned in and hanging on every word. Limbaugh expounds the virtues of the Republican Party. While most political pundits believe, Limbaugh is the leader of a conservative revolution in the US he is not alone.

Bill O’Reilly and Sean Hannity are two other conservative professional radio hosts vying for the number one spot. Using TV as a venue O’Reilly and Hannity have access to mainstream America, a path Limbaugh pursued and left behind years ago.

Bill O’reilly’s cable news show The O’Reilly Factor and his radio program The Radio Factor helps to propel him up the political broadcast ladder. Sean Hannity has a nationally syndicated radio program which airs throughout the United States on ABC Radio Networks. Various sources purport Hannity signed a $25 million five-year contract extension with ABC Radio.
